A favourite watering hole for students at the University of Manchester, Jabez Clegg is a surprisingly large and welcoming pub, just off Oxford Road. With a large upstairs room which sometimes plays host to live music and club nights, and a big screen downstairs showing live sports, the atmosphere is often lively, with groups of students chattering round the venue's various booths. Prices are reasonable, as would be expected in a student pub, and the staff are friendly.

This is a bar/restuarant/nightclub. As a bar it ranks really well, as it has massive leather seats and large screens to watch sky sports. Its located in the middle of the University of Manchester, so for students its ideal to pop in and have lunch or drown your sorrows after completing your exams. This place serves the biggest burgers. The burgers are as big as you face, I mean this literally. In the night, it is mainly used as a live venue for gigs and club. The nights that are run vary from metallic rock to karoake and jazz. The place is really massive and has a good number of rooms which you can rent out for a private party or meetings. Many university societies tend to hold their event here. Highly recommended for the food.

This is a bar right in the heart of Manchester's Universities and is well known among students and locals alike. Downstairs is the beer hall, a great meeting place for a chilled out drink at the start of the evening or before a gig across the road at the Academy. The clubs is upstairs and are open late with regular club nights, including a popular student night on Thursdays. Its very cheap to drink here with loads of great drink offers on pints and shots etc. Its really popular and is busy every Friday & Saturday. It plays a mixture of funky house, dance, pop and disco.
